How to pray for a successful surgery and recovery

When you have surgery, it’s important to remember to pray for a successful recovery. Here are some tips on how to do that:

1. Pray for the best possible outcome. If there’s anything you can think of that would make the surgery go more smoothly, pray for that too.
2. Pray for strength and courage during the surgery. Know that you’re not alone in this process and that God is with you.
3. Pray for healing both mentally and physically. Ask God to help you get better as soon as possible, both mentally and physically.
4. Thank God for His presence during the entire process. Whether or not you’re conscious, know that He is with you every step of the way.

Dear God, Thank you for giving me the strength to go through this surgery and recover. I know that You are with me every step of the way, and I am confident that I will be able to come out on the other side a stronger person. Please help me to stay focused during my recovery so that I can get back to my normal life as quickly as possible. Thank you for answering my prayer for a successful surgery and recovery. Amen
